This solicitation, identified as SPMYM226Q7659 and titled COPPUS VENTAIR, is a total small business set-aside under NAICS code 333413, managed by the Department of Defense through DLA Maritime - Puget Sound. Offers must be submitted electronically via email to armando.saya@dla.mil and must include a fully completed and signed solicitation form with the quoted price, contractor information including CAGE code, point of contact details, lead time or delivery date, manufacturer information per Section K, and compliance declarations for FAR 52.204-24. All quotes must specify FOB Destination Silverdale, WA and be received by 10:00 AM PST on July 9, 2026. Contractors must adhere to NIST SP 800-171 requirements unless the items being quoted are Commercial Off the Shelf, in which case they must identify and provide documentation of COTS status during submission. The solicitation was posted on SAM.gov on July 6, 2026, and any amendments will also be posted there.

BOAST RFOP - Diffuser Assembly - NSN: 2540-01-200-5821
Solicitation # PANDTA-26-P-032936
The Army Contracting Command - Detroit Arsenal is soliciting proposals under the Basic Ordering Agreement Sustainment Track program for a firm-fixed-price order of 76 Diffuser Assemblies, part number 12324202, NSN 2540-01-200-5821. This is a total small business set-aside action under NAICS 333413. Eligibility is strictly limited to vendors with a fully executed BOAST Basic Ordering Agreement in place by the closing date. Per Amendment 002, the maximum option ceiling has been increased to 200 percent, allowing for a second option of 76 units within a 365-day period. The final proposal submission deadline is September 17, 2026, at 1600 hours EST. The award will be based on the Lowest Price Technically Acceptable method, with price as the sole evaluation factor. Delivery is required within 300 calendar days after receipt of order, with shipping terms as FOB Destination and inspection and acceptance occurring at the origin. The item is export-controlled, requiring vendors to be certified in the Joint Certification Program to access the Technical Data Package. Strict compliance is required for military packaging and preservation standards, specifically MIL-STD-2073-1D and Special Packaging Instruction AK12005821. Additionally, contractors must adhere to comprehensive security requirements, including NIST SP 800-171 for safeguarding covered defense information, OPSEC plan compliance, and mandatory Counterintelligence Awareness and Reporting training.
